Google to allow phone calls from Gmail

Tech giant Google Inc says that Gmail users will now be able to call telephones directly from their email.


Google already provides computer-to-computer voice and video chat services. But the company said that it is for the first time that they will be allowing calls to home phones and mobile phones directly from Gmail.Google promised free calls to US and Canadian phones from Gmail for the rest of this year and said it would charge low rates for calls made to other countries.For example it said calls to Britain, France, Germany, China and Japan would be as low as two cents per minute.

Gmail user Manish Singh says that he is waiting for that day when Google will extend this service for their Indian subscribers.


Analysts said the service would likely be a bigger competitive threat to services like Skype`s than to traditional phone companies, which have already been cutting their call prices in recent years in response to stiff competition.


"This is a risk to Skype. It`s a competitor with a pretty good brand name," said Hudson Square analyst Todd Rethemeier.


Like Skype, Rethemeier said the Google service will likely be much more popular among US consumers making international calls, than among people calling friends inside the country.


"Calling is so cheap already that I don`t think it will attract a huge amount of domestic calling. It could take some of the international market," he said.

Farmers sieged capital, blocked key roads

There seems to be no end to the woes of Delhites as all the major roads leading to Central Delhi,particularly parliament street and Connaught Place, were blocked on Thursday by thousands of belligerent farmers.

They came here to gherao parliament later today to press their demand for better compensation when government acquire their land. The impasse of their large presence has already crippled the traffic in central Delhi.

The traffic movement was affected at Rajghat, Jawaharlal Nehru Marg, Barakhamba Road, Kasturba Gandhi Marg, Janpath, Ranjit Singh Marg and Tolstoy Marg. Movement towards the New Delhi railway station through Ajmere Gate was also be affected by traffic jams at Ajmere Gate, Darya Ganj and Chandni Chowk

According to the Delhi and Ghaziabad police sources, around 12,000-14,000 farmers have descended in the national capital, in a bid to protest against the `forceful` acquisition of land for the Yamuna Expressway a dream project of UP chief minister Mayawati.

With the ruling Congress party expressing its support to the `cause`, there was a "considerable presence" of farmers in the capital as expected. Farmers arrived in Delhi

Earlier, Rashtriya Lok Dal leader Ajit Singh has given a nation-wide call to farmers for Parliament gherao with the slogan Sansad ghero, zamin bachao (Ring Parliament, Save Land).

Even as the Uttar Pradesh government is trying to assuage farmers whose land has been acquired for the Yamuna expressway at throwaway prices, Mr Singh met Prime Minister Manmohan Singh here to seek his intervention for re-introducing the lapsed land Acquisition (Amendment) Bill, 2009, in Parliament.

Earlier this week, the National Democratic Alliance and some other parties also raised a demand in Parliament for re-introduction of the Bill.

King Khan to perform in Commonwealth Games

Amidst all the controversies that has so far dogged the forthcoming commonwealth games, here is a good news that Shahrukh Khan is to perform in the opening ceremony of the games on October 3.

Sources close to Commonwealth games organising committee says that King Khan would give a dance performance in the presence of jam-packed Jawaharlal Nehru stadium. While it is still not known exactly what kind of performace he would give, it is sure that Shahrukh Khan is going to make his presence felt during theopening ceremony.

It may be recalled that Oscar-winning music composer AR Rahman has composed the theme song for the games-- Swagatham.

Rahman presented his song to a committee of ministers appointed to oversee the progress of the six-billion-dollar Games organization, which has been plagued by charges of corruption. Urban Development Minister Jaipal Reddy heads the group, which includes Sports Minister MS Gill and Delhi Chief Minister Sheila Dikshit, among others. Rahman seemed reluctant to reveal much more about the song when journalists asked him to reveal about it.

It’s kind of Waka Waka?” one journalist asked, referring to the song Colombian pop star Shakira sang for the FIFA World Cup in South Africa this year. “Exactly no,” said Mr Rahman.
